Deep learning can't patch its own blind spots, researcher argues — that's why it stalls

ryunuck · x · 2026-09-21

The author argues deep learning is inefficient and hitting walls because you cannot inspect the weights (the model's internal model of reality) to pinpoint where its understanding is inaccurate. The model therefore cannot direct its own learning to optimally patch holes in that understanding — a limitation the author deems unsolvable, implying vertical timelines (compounding capability gains) won't happen since inaccuracy just shifts elsewhere. An opinion piece, not an empirical study.
